Abdul Almagableh Eliminated in 16th Place ($22,226)

Level 27 : 25,000/50,000, 5,000 ante

Abdul Almagableh opened to 105,000 and Kong Li called in late position. The flop came {Q-Clubs}{7-Spades}{5-Clubs} and Almagableh led out for 160,000. After finding out how much Almagableh had behind Li raised to 355,000. Thinking Li had set him all in, Almagableh tossed in a stack of chips and said "I call." Once he was told that it was not all in, he said "I'm all in the dark then."

The dealer put out the {J-Clubs} on the turn and Li called and turned over {Q-Spades}{J-Diamonds} for top two pair. "Ahhhhhhh, got lucky," moaned Almagableh as he turned over {K-Hearts}{Q-Hearts}. The river was the {10-Spades} and Almagableh would be eliminated in 16th place. Li moved to 2.4 million in chips.
